DRUGS MISUSE ACT 1986 - SECT 43F

Employee’s liability

43F Employee’s liability

(1) In this section—

"information requirements" means the requirements under the following sections—
†¢ section 43D
†¢ section 43E .
(2) This section applies to an employee who in the ordinary course of employment has the task of complying with the information requirements for the employee’s employer.
(3) If the employee intentionally or recklessly fails to comply with the information requirements, the employee commits an offence.
Penalty—
Maximum penalty—
(a) for a first offence—20 penalty units; or
(b) for a second or later offence—40 penalty units.
(4) In a proceeding, evidence that an employee supplied, or helped in the supply of, a controlled substance or controlled thing under a relevant transaction is evidence that the employee had the task mentioned in subsection (2) .
